Title: A Glimpse into the Past: Church of England Confirmation, 1820 This evocative image, captured in the early 19th century, offers a fascinating glimpse into the Church of England confirmation process during this historical period. The photograph, held in the extensive collection of Mary Evans Picture Library, transports us back in time, allowing us to witness an essential rite of passage in the Anglican faith. Confirmation, a sacrament in the Church of England, marks the affirmation and strengthening of a Christian's faith and commitment to the church. In this image, we see a young boy, dressed in the traditional confirmation attire, standing before the bishop. The bishop, wearing his ceremonial robes and mitre, lays his hands on the boy's head in the act of confirmation. Surrounding them are other members of the congregation, observing the sacred moment with reverence and devotion. The setting of the confirmation takes place in a grand, ornate church, with stained glass windows casting a warm, colorful light over the scene. The intricate details of the church architecture and the somber, yet hopeful expressions on the faces of those present, serve as a reminder of the deep-rooted traditions and beliefs that have shaped the Church of England for centuries. This photograph is a valuable historical record, offering insight into the religious practices and customs of the 19th century. It serves as a testament to the enduring significance of the Church of England in English history and culture. The image invites us to reflect on the continuity of faith and tradition, as well as the transformative power of confirmation in the lives of those who participate in this sacred rite.
